  • Ease of Use
    Auth0 provides an intuitive dashboard and extensive documentation, making it easy for developers to implement authentication and authorization in their applications.
  • Security
    Auth0 offers robust security features such as multi-factor authentication, anomaly detection, and brute-force protection to ensure the safety of user data.
  • Scalability
    Being a cloud-based service, Auth0 easily scales with growing application demands, accommodating increasing numbers of users and higher authentication requests.
  • Customization
    Auth0 allows for a high degree of customization in authentication workflows, including custom login pages, rules, and hooks that tailor the service to specific application needs.
  • Integrations
    Auth0 supports a wide variety of integrations with social identity providers, enterprise systems, and custom databases, making it versatile for different use cases.
  • Compliance
    Auth0 complies with various industry standards and regulations such as GDPR, HIPAA, and SOC2, providing assurance for businesses operating in regulated environments.

Possible disadvantages

  • Cost
    Auth0 can be expensive for smaller projects or startups as the pricing scales with the number of active users and advanced features, potentially becoming cost-prohibitive.
  • Complexity for Simple Use Cases
    For simple authentication needs, Auth0 might be overkill, offering more features and configurations than necessary, making it potentially cumbersome.
  • Vendor Lock-in
    Relying on Auth0 means dependency on a third-party provider for critical authentication infrastructure, which can be a risk if service terms change or if there are service outages.
  • Learning Curve
    While the extensive features of Auth0 are a strength, they also mean that there is a learning curve, especially for developers who are new to identity and access management.
  • Performance
    There can be occasional performance issues or latency, particularly during peak times or depending on geographic location, which might affect user experience.
  • Limited Free Tier
    The free tier of Auth0 is limited in terms of the number of active users and features, which might not be sufficient for some projects to adequately test the platform.
  • Performance
    NumPy operations are executed with highly optimized C and Fortran libraries, making them significantly faster than standard Python arithmetic operations, especially for large datasets.
  • Versatility
    NumPy supports a vast range of mathematical, logical, shape manipulation, sorting, selecting, I/O, and basic linear algebra operations, making it a versatile tool for scientific and numeric computing.
  • Ease of Use
    NumPy provides an intuitive, easy-to-understand syntax that extends Python's ability to handle arrays and matrices, lowering the barrier to performing complex scientific computations.
  • Community Support
    With a large and active community, NumPy offers extensive documentation, tutorials, and support for troubleshooting issues, as well as continuous updates and enhancements.
  • Integrations
    NumPy integrates seamlessly with other libraries in Python's scientific stack like SciPy, Matplotlib, and Pandas, facilitating a streamlined workflow for data science and analysis tasks.

Possible disadvantages

  • Memory Consumption
    NumPy arrays can consume large amounts of memory, especially when working with very large datasets, which can become a limitation on systems with limited memory capacity.
  • Learning Curve
    For users new to scientific computing or coming from different programming backgrounds, understanding the intricacies of NumPy's operations and efficient usage can take time and effort.
  • Limited GPU Support
    NumPy primarily runs on the CPU and doesn't natively support GPU acceleration, which can be a disadvantage for extremely compute-intensive tasks that could benefit from parallel processing.
  • Dependency on Python
    Since NumPy is a Python library, it depends on the Python runtime environment. This can be a limitation in environments where Python is not the primary language or isn't supported.
  • Indexing Complexity
    Although NumPy's slicing and indexing capabilities are powerful, they can sometimes be complex or unintuitive, especially for multi-dimensional arrays, leading to potential errors and confusion.
